- The was the paper from an invited talk at the ECI conference on Nanomechanical testing in Materials Research and Development in Olhao, Portugal, October 6-11 (2013). The work develops a simple analytical approximation method for determining the elastic properties of thin coatings from nanoindentation tests on the coating/substrate system without the need for detailed finite element analysis. The technique is specifically useful because it can easily be adapted to multilayer and fictionally gradient coatings which cannot be analysed by more accurate methods and resulted in six further publications.
